Yahoo introduced a new version of its messenger service, which has now gotten up to version 7.0, last week with VoIP integration. The new version is still in Beta stage, but it lets users talk to buddies directly from their computer. Users will still be able to text message while on the phone. According to Yahoo, both users will be required to have the latest 7.0 in order to take advantage of its VoIP service. Yahoo said its users wont be able to call a traditional landline phone, but its VoIP service will be similar to the traditional phone companies, as Yahoo will offer voicemail functionality as well. Yahoo said users would also be able to choose the way they want to be contacted by others. They can choose from regular text messages, Internet phone calls, text messages on cell phones or via e-mail. Additional Yahoo features are either built-in or connected via the messenger for easy access. Some of these features include photo sharing capabilities, personal profiles, and free blogging tools.
